Book Intermodal Freight Transport and Logistics

Download or read book Intermodal Freight Transport and Logistics written by Jason Monios and published by CRC Press. This book was released on 2017-06-14 with total page 231 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Applying sophisticated management techniques to freight transport offers the potential for significant cost savings as well as greater efficiency. Yet the inherent complexity of intermodal transport presents many challenges. This practical textbook on the operations of intermodal transport and logistics focuses on the practical concerns and the basics of operations, such as vehicles, containers, handling operations, logistics management and optimisation. All chapters are written by field specialists, and the volume includes additional chapters on economics, law and the environment to put the practical topics into context. It presents a balanced textbook for postgraduate students and also a reference text for those in industry or the public sector involved in the planning of intermodal freight transport.

Book International Logistics and Freight Forwarding Manual

Download or read book International Logistics and Freight Forwarding Manual written by Burke, Russell John and published by . This book was released on 2011 with total page 730 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The International Freight Forwarding and Logistics Manual is used throughout Australia in the training of International Freight Forwarders, and in colleges as a reference and practical guide in the study of International Transport and Trade.This edition is a complete revision and expansion, and covers most factors involved in International Freight Forwarding, Trade and Transport. It aims to provide the reader, whether a forwarder, trader, customs broker, or simply an interested student, with the necessary knowledge and skills to enable the achievement of the common objectives of traders and forwarders when selling, buying and moving cargo internationally.The book includes a Dictionary of Terms and chapters on the following topics: The International Forwarding & Customs Broking Industry in Australia; Sale Contracts and Incoterms®; Shipping & Aircargo Services; Australian Domestic Transport ¿ An Overview; Freight Rates & Shipment Costs; Route Selection; Export Bookings, Clearances, & Cargo Receival in Australia; Packing, Stowing, Marking and Containerisation of Cargo; Cargo Insurance; Surveys and other inspections of cargo; Australian Government export/import controls and processes; Duty Drawback & the Tradex Scheme; Documentation, including many samples of documents; Contracts of Carriage, International Conventions relating to the Carriage of Goods, Bills of Lading and Air Waybills; Special Cargoes - Perishables, Art Works, High value, and Exhibition goods; Dangerous Goods Transportation; Aviation Transport Security; Foreign Country Import Formalities;Written in easy to understand language, the book provides a vast amount of valuable information, and is an essential tool for reference libraries or for persons studying International Trade or Logistics.

Book Multi objective Management in Freight Logistics

Download or read book Multi objective Management in Freight Logistics written by Massimiliano Caramia and published by Springer Nature. This book was released on 2020-07-30 with total page 206 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The second edition of Multi-Objective Management in Freight Logistics builds upon the first, providing a detailed study of freight transportation systems, with a specific focus on multi-objective modelling. It offers decision-makers methods and tools for implementing multi-objective optimisation models in logistics. The second edition also includes brand-new chapters on green supply chain and hybrid fleet management problems. After presenting the general framework and multi-objective optimization, the book analyses green logistic focusing on two main aspects: green corridors and network design; next, it studies logistic issues in a maritime terminal and route planning in the context of hazardous material transportation. Finally, heterogeneous fleets distribution and coordination models are discussed. The book presents problems providing the mathematics, algorithms, implementations, and the related experiments for each problem. It offers a valuable resource for postgraduate students and researchers in transportation, logistics and operations, as well as practitioners working in service systems.

Book Training in Logistics and the Freight Transport Industry

Download or read book Training in Logistics and the Freight Transport Industry written by Alfonso Morvillo and published by Routledge. This book was released on 2017-11-01 with total page 220 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This title was first published in 2002. In the last few decades, relationships within the transport and logistics industry have become more complex due to the rising importance of information and communication technology, the growth of just-in-time delivery and increasing globalization. Such changes call for new forms of training, both managerial and vocational, for the continued development of the industry. This detailed and enterprising volume focuses on the transnational integrated training FIT Project (Formazione Integrata Transnazionale) set up within the European Programme ADAPT, which brought together academics and professionals to boost transport and logistics in Southern Italy. The project highlights cultural, motivational and training differences among the companies studied and suggests proper strategies for human resource development. Through an original methodology, it advocates an innovative and modular training programme to meet the needs of expertise and flexibility within the sector. The results can be used by the industry in general as best practice operative guidelines.

Book Transport Logistics

Download or read book Transport Logistics written by Issa Baluch and published by . This book was released on 2005 with total page 322 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This expansive, well-researched work could rank as one of the most inclusive, complete books on the esoteric topic of freight logistics and that field's role in shaping modern civilization. The book's wide scope and historic perspective make the topic come alive, enhanced by its architectural, engineering, military and relief effort case studies. The pace slows when author Issa Baluch discusses the transportation infrastructures of Egypt, India and Dubai, in sections that may be too detailed for most readers. Similarly, some of the case studies go into excessive detail about the actual contents of what was shipped for specific efforts, such as the Berlin airlift. However, despite these minor distractions, people in the transportation industry will find this manuscript revealing. Although it may be long and dry at times, getAbstract.com was intrigued by its historic overview of transportation logistics.
